Hemant Vishwakarma SEOBACKDIRECTORY.COM seohelpdesk96@gmail.com
Welcome to SEOBACKDIRECTORY.COM
Email Us - seohelpdesk96@gmail.com
directory-link.com | webdirectorylink.com | smartseoarticle.com | directory-web.com | smartseobacklink.com | theseobacklink.com | smart-article.com

Article -> Article Details

Title Which Modeling Tools Are Taught in a Business Analyst Course?
Category Education --> Continuing Education and Certification
Meta Keywords Online training on business analysis
Owner Jessica
Description

Introduction

In today’s data-driven business world, every decision is guided by insights, not assumptions. Business Analysts (BAs) act as the bridge between business needs and technical implementation. They interpret stakeholder requirements, define processes, and ensure solutions meet business goals.

But here’s the catch: no matter how strong a BA’s analytical thinking is, their success largely depends on how effectively they can visualize business processes, requirements, and data flows. This is where modeling tools become indispensable.

If you’re exploring online training on business analysis or planning to enroll in a Business Analyst course with certificate, understanding which modeling tools you’ll learn and how they’re applied in real-world scenarios  is crucial.

This blog breaks down the most important modeling tools taught in a Business Analyst course, their applications, and how each tool prepares you for live projects and enterprise environments.

What Are Modeling Tools in Business Analysis?

Modeling tools are software applications that help business analysts document, visualize, and analyze business processes, data relationships, and system behaviors. They translate abstract business requirements into structured visual diagrams or data models.

These models provide clarity to both technical and non-technical stakeholders. Instead of long requirement documents, visual models show how processes work, how data moves, and how users interact with systems.

Common Modeling Types in Business Analysis

Business Analyst courses teach modeling through various categories:

  • Process Modeling: Describes workflows and activities (using tools like Lucidchart or Bizagi).

  • Data Modeling: Defines how data is structured and related (using ER/Studio or MySQL Workbench).

  • Use Case Modeling: Shows interactions between users and systems (using UML tools like Enterprise Architect).

  • Requirement Modeling: Organizes and tracks requirements using visual structures (like JIRA or Confluence diagrams).

Now, let’s explore the specific tools that every Business Analyst course for beginners includes and how they are applied in live project environments.

Microsoft Visio – The Industry Standard for Process Modeling

Microsoft Visio remains one of the most widely taught modeling tools in any Business Analyst course with certificate. It enables analysts to create process flowcharts, organizational charts, and system diagrams with ease.

Why Business Analysts Learn Visio

  • It helps visualize As-Is and To-Be processes.

  • It simplifies workflow documentation for business process re-engineering.

  • It integrates well with Microsoft Office, making documentation seamless.

Example in Practice

Imagine a BA working with a healthcare company to streamline patient admissions.
Using Visio, they map the current (As-Is) process  from patient registration to billing  and then design an improved To-Be process with automated data entry points.

This helps stakeholders visualize efficiency gains before implementation.

Lucidchart – Cloud-Based Diagramming for Collaboration

Lucidchart is a modern, web-based tool that supports real-time collaboration. It’s often introduced early in online training on business analysis because it’s intuitive and supports multiple modeling notations.

Why It’s Popular Among BAs

  • Cloud-based and easy to access from any location.

  • Allows teams to collaborate on the same diagram simultaneously.

  • Supports multiple diagram types: BPMN, flowcharts, wireframes, and ERDs.

Use Case Example

A BA team working remotely designs a business process model for an e-commerce order management system using Lucidchart.
They use BPMN notation to show every step  order placement, payment processing, inventory checks, and delivery updates.
Lucidchart’s live collaboration makes feedback and approvals quick, saving project time.

Draw.io (diagrams.net)  Open-Source and Versatile

Many Business Analyst courses for beginners introduce Draw.io as a free, open-source alternative to commercial diagramming tools. It’s user-friendly and ideal for beginners learning process flow modeling.

Key Benefits

  • Free and browser-based.

  • Integrates with Google Drive and Atlassian tools.

  • Supports UML, BPMN, and network diagrams.

Real-World Relevance

For startups or small businesses where paid tools aren’t feasible, Draw.io helps analysts create professional visual models that communicate requirements effectively.
For example, a BA designing a customer feedback process can create a clean flowchart using Draw.io and share it instantly via Google Workspace.

Bizagi Modeler – BPMN Mastery for Process Optimization

When learning business process modeling, Bizagi Modeler is one of the most comprehensive tools covered in professional BA training.

It’s designed specifically for Business Process Model and Notation (BPMN) diagrams  a global standard for process mapping.

What You Learn in the Course

  • Process documentation using BPMN symbols.

  • Simulation of process workflows to identify bottlenecks.

  • Exporting models to share with developers and stakeholders.

Case Example

In a live project simulation during training, learners use Bizagi to model an HR onboarding process.
The tool helps identify redundant manual steps and allows simulation of improvements before automation is proposed.

This builds hands-on analytical and visualization skills that directly apply in the workplace.

Enterprise Architect – Advanced Modeling and UML Design

Enterprise Architect by Sparx Systems is a powerful tool used in enterprise-level projects. It’s often included in Business Analyst courses with certificates for learners advancing into complex systems or software projects.

Why It’s Important

  • Supports Unified Modeling Language (UML) for software requirement analysis.

  • Helps create use case diagrams, class diagrams, and sequence diagrams.

  • Enables integration with Agile methodologies.

Real-World Use

Consider a banking system upgrade project:
The BA uses Enterprise Architect to design use case diagrams for customer transactions. Developers then use these diagrams to build functional modules, ensuring requirements are aligned from start to finish.

IBM Rational RequisitePro (or DOORS) – Requirement Management Excellence

When requirements management is the focus, tools like IBM Rational RequisitePro or DOORS are introduced.

These help analysts capture, track, and manage requirements effectively throughout the project lifecycle.

Benefits of Learning This Tool

  • Traceability: Link business requirements to functional and test requirements.

  • Version control and change management.

  • Integration with testing and project management tools.

Example

In a manufacturing automation project, a BA uses DOORS to track every requirement  from safety standards to system response times  ensuring complete traceability during audits.

JIRA – Agile Requirement and User Story Management

No online training on business analysis is complete without JIRA. It’s not just a project management tool  it’s also a requirement visualization and collaboration platform used across Agile teams.

What You Learn

  • Creating and managing user stories.

  • Defining epics, sprints, and acceptance criteria.

  • Using JIRA dashboards for tracking progress.

Real-World Application

A BA in an Agile software project documents features for a new mobile app.
They use JIRA to write user stories like:
“As a user, I want to log in using my social media accounts so that I can access the app easily.”

Developers and testers then align their work based on this story, making JIRA a central collaboration hub.

Confluence Documentation and Collaboration

Confluence, often paired with JIRA, is a documentation and collaboration platform. Business Analyst courses teach it as part of Agile documentation practices.

What You Learn

  • Creating Business Requirement Documents (BRDs).

  • Maintaining a centralized knowledge base.

  • Collaborating on wireframes, models, and process documentation.

Real Example

A BA team uses Confluence to maintain the requirement traceability matrix (RTM), linking every stakeholder's need to specific deliverables.
This ensures nothing is lost between analysis and implementation.

Balsamiq  Wireframing and Prototyping

While not strictly a process modeling tool, Balsamiq is taught in most Business Analyst courses for beginners for UI/UX wireframing.

It allows BAs to visualize how users will interact with an application before development begins.

Skills Gained

  • Creating mockups of user interfaces.

  • Aligning user stories with UI elements.

  • Gathering feedback early in design stages.

Example

In an e-commerce project, a BA uses Balsamiq to design the checkout page layout. This helps stakeholders understand how the new system will appear and function, avoiding late-stage design revisions.

MySQL Workbench / ER/Studio  Data Modeling Tools

Data modeling is a crucial part of business analysis, especially for analysts working with reporting, analytics, or data migration projects.

What You Learn

  • Designing Entity-Relationship Diagrams (ERDs).

  • Defining data attributes, primary keys, and foreign keys.

  • Mapping data flow between systems.

Example

A BA working on a retail analytics project uses MySQL Workbench to design a data model showing relationships between customer data, transactions, and inventory.
This model ensures the data warehouse supports accurate reporting.

Power BI Visualizing Business Insights

Power BI is increasingly part of online training on business analysis because modern BAs are expected to interpret and visualize data insights.

Why It Matters

  • Allows integration of business and analytical skills.

  • Helps present KPIs and dashboards for decision-making.

  • Encourages data-driven analysis.

Example

A BA creates a Power BI dashboard showing customer churn rates and satisfaction metrics.
This visual insight helps management adjust retention strategies quickly.

Miro Collaborative Whiteboarding

Modern business environments prioritize real-time collaboration, making Miro another popular inclusion in Business Analyst certification programs.

Key Learning Points

  • Brainstorming workflows and stakeholder maps.

  • Creating mind maps for requirement gathering.

  • Running virtual design thinking sessions.

Real-World Application

During remote workshops, a BA uses Miro to engage stakeholders in designing customer journey maps.
The visual, interactive workspace promotes team alignment.

Visual Paradigm  Advanced Process and Data Modeling

Visual Paradigm is a versatile tool that covers UML, BPMN, ERD, and more. It’s often included in advanced business analyst courses.

What Students Learn

  • Process simulation and requirement validation.

  • Generating documentation directly from models.

  • Integrating visual models with software specifications.

Example

For a logistics company’s automation project, a BA uses Visual Paradigm to model supply chain workflows, ensuring all stakeholders understand dependencies before execution.

The Role of Modeling Tools in Live Projects

In a Business Analyst course with a certificate, learners apply these tools in live projects to bridge theory and practice.

Typical Live Project Scenarios

  1. Process Optimization Project:
    Learners use Bizagi and Visio to redesign a customer onboarding workflow.

  2. Requirement Management Simulation:
    Students use JIRA and Confluence to document and trace business requirements through to delivery.

  3. Data Modeling Challenge:
    Teams create ERDs and dashboards using MySQL Workbench and Power BI.

  4. Wireframe Development:
    Participants create mock interfaces using Balsamiq to support UI documentation.

These projects give students real-world exposure to industry practices, making them confident and job-ready upon certification.

How Modeling Tools Empower Business Analysts

Learning modeling tools offers BAs several long-term benefits:

  • Clarity: Visual diagrams simplify communication between business and technical teams.

  • Traceability: Tools maintain a single source of truth for all project requirements.

  • Efficiency: Automated workflows and templates speed up documentation.

  • Decision-Making: Analytical tools like Power BI empower data-driven recommendations.

In a competitive job market, mastering these tools positions you as a versatile professional who can operate across technical and business domains.

Conclusion

Modeling tools are the heartbeat of every successful business analysis project. Whether it’s process visualization, data design, or requirement documentation, mastering these tools sets you apart as a strategic thinker and solution designer.

If you’re just starting your journey, a Business Analyst course for beginners will help you gain the confidence to apply these tools in real-world scenarios  from process modeling to agile project delivery.

Key Takeaways

  • Modeling tools help visualize and communicate complex business needs.

  • Tools like Visio, Lucidchart, JIRA, and Power BI are must-haves for every analyst.

  • Real-world projects during training ensure job readiness.

  • Certification courses combine practical application with analytical insight.